NEW PALTZ, N.Y. – The State University of New York at New Paltz men's swimming team will host State University of New York Athletic Conference (SUNYAC) foe Cortland on Friday, Jan. 16 at 4 p.m.
RECORDS: The Hawks are 2-0 in dual meets this year, defeating Oswego and Vassar… The Red Dragons are 0-4 after falling at Hartwick on Saturday, Jan. 10.

SCOUTING THE RED DRAGONS (0-4): Cortland fell at Hartwick on Jan. 10, 156-119… Junior Reeve Callen won the 50 free (21.97) while senior Mark Hanifin placed first in the 500 free (5:00.03)… Junior Jack Jakubek placed second in the 100 breast (1:02.67) with sophomore Dylan Burns turning in a second-place time in the 100 back (55.06)… Senior Brandon McManus took second in the 1,000 free (10:40.49)… Callen placed second in the 100 free (48.30) and Hanifin claimed second in the 200 free (1:46.43)… Last season against New Paltz, then-freshman Jamie Miller won the 100 breast (1:06.99).
LAST DUAL MEET: New Paltz defeated Cortland 144-101 when these two programs last met on Jan. 17, 2014.
